Big Ideas (LP)
Remi Wolf
Amoeba Review
California singer/songwriter Remi Wolf writes quirky alt-pop with catchy melodies and blunt, relatable lyrics. The music in "Pitiful" is wildly infectious and upbeat, but it's cleverly contrasted with self-deprecating, heartbroken lyrics. Phrases like "Soak up the sound of crypto bros" add a wry touch to a song about partying and feeling lonely (the indie pop gem "Alone in Miami"). Elsewhere, "Cinderella" is an unexpectedly funky blast complete with '70s-style horns.
